Pitcher Trevor Bauer Released By Los Angeles Dodgers

The Los Angeles Dodgers released pitcher Trevor Bauer on Thursday, after he  recently completed a 194-game suspension for violating the MLB-MLBPA Joint Domestic Violence, Sexual Assault and Child Abuse Policy. The decision to drop Bauer was expected throughout the baseball industry for the past few months, according to ESPN. In April, Bauer was suspended for two seasons after sexual assault ...

Former Los Angeles Dodger, Yasiel Puig, Agrees To Plead Guilty For Illegal Gambling Operation

Former Los Angeles Dodger Yasiel Puig is expected to plead guilty to making false statements to federal law enforcement officials regarding bets totaling more than a quarter million dollars that he placed with an illegal gambling operation. Puig, who played with the Dodgers from 2013-2018, has agreed to pay a fine of at least $55,000 and make his initial appearance ...
